DefaultTrialId

Output only. The default trial_id to use in TVFs when the trial_id is not passed in. For single-objective hyperparameter tuning models, this is the best trial ID. For multi-objective hyperparameter tuning models, this is the smallest trial ID among all Pareto optimal trials.

Declaration
[JsonProperty("defaultTrialId")]
public virtual long? DefaultTrialId { get; set; }
Property Value
Type Description
long?

EncryptionConfiguration

Custom encryption configuration (e.g., Cloud KMS keys). This shows the encryption configuration of the model data while stored in BigQuery storage. This field can be used with PatchModel to update encryption key for an already encrypted model.

Declaration
[JsonProperty("encryptionConfiguration")]
public virtual EncryptionConfiguration EncryptionConfiguration { get; set; }
Property Value
Type Description
EncryptionConfiguration

ExpirationTime

Optional. The time when this model expires, in milliseconds since the epoch. If not present, the model will persist indefinitely. Expired models will be deleted and their storage reclaimed. The defaultTableExpirationMs property of the encapsulating dataset can be used to set a default expirationTime on newly created models.

Declaration
[JsonProperty("expirationTime")]
public virtual long? ExpirationTime { get; set; }
Property Value
Type Description
long?

Labels

The labels associated with this model. You can use these to organize and group your models. Label keys and values can be no longer than 63 characters, can only contain lowercase letters, numeric characters, underscores and dashes. International characters are allowed. Label values are optional. Label keys must start with a letter and each label in the list must have a different key.

Declaration
[JsonProperty("labels")]
public virtual IDictionary<string, string> Labels { get; set; }
Property Value
Type Description
IDictionary<string, string>

TransformColumns

Output only. This field will be populated if a TRANSFORM clause was used to train a model. TRANSFORM clause (if used) takes feature_columns as input and outputs transform_columns. transform_columns then are used to train the model.

Declaration
[JsonProperty("transformColumns")]
public virtual IList<TransformColumn> TransformColumns { get; set; }
Property Value
Type Description
IList<TransformColumn>
